Wacker present new silicones at SEPAWA

Published: 9-Nov-2006

At the 53rd SEPAWA Congress in Würzburg, Germany, Wacker presented alkyl-modified silicone waxes for the formulation of shampoos and conditioners.

Lab tests show that these silicone wax gels, including Wacker-Belsil CDM 3526 VP and high-melting Wacker-Belsil CM 7026 VP, significantly enhance the compatibility of both wet and dry hair. Plus silicone waxes lend hair more volume and a softer feel. Wacker says that the products can also be used to enhance the properties of sunscreen creams, lipsticks, foundation and mascara. An example of this is silicone wax gel CDM 3526 VP, which boosts the spreading of oil constituents in skin care products.
